still making both branches closer
[nepi.git] / src / nepi / util / manifoldapi.py
index c9ff344..5172410 100644 (file)
@@ -3,9 +3,8 @@
 #    Copyright (C) 2013 INRIA
 #
 #    This program is free software: you can redistribute it and/or modify
-#    it under the terms of the GNU General Public License as published by
-#    the Free Software Foundation, either version 3 of the License, or
-#    (at your option) any later version.
+#    it under the terms of the GNU General Public License version 2 as
+#    published by the Free Software Foundation;
 #
 #    This program is distributed in the hope that it will be useful,
 #    but WITHOUT ANY WARRANTY; without even the implied warranty of
@@ -17,6 +16,8 @@
 #
 # Author: Lucia Guevgeozian Odizzio <lucia.guevgeozian_odizzio@inria.fr>
 
+from __future__ import print_function
+
 import xmlrpclib
 import hashlib
 import threading
@@ -51,7 +52,7 @@ class MANIFOLDAPI(object):
 
         if not session['value']:
             msg = "Can not authenticate in Manifold API"
-            raise RuntimeError, msg
+            raise RuntimeError(msg)
 
         session_key = session['value'][0]['session']
         return dict(AuthMethod='session', session=session_key)
@@ -71,7 +72,7 @@ class MANIFOLDAPI(object):
             filters = self._map_attr_to_resource_filters(filters)
 
             qfilters = list()
-            for filtername, filtervalue in filters.iteritems():
+            for filtername, filtervalue in filters.items():
                 newfilter = [filtername, "==", filtervalue]
                 qfilters.append(newfilter)
             
@@ -135,7 +136,7 @@ class MANIFOLDAPI(object):
             return True
         else:
             msg = "Failed while trying to add %s to slice" % resource_urn
-            print msg
+            print(msg)
             # check how to do warning
             return False
 
@@ -201,7 +202,7 @@ class MANIFOLDAPI(object):
         }
 
         mapped_filters = dict()
-        for filtername, filtervalue in filters.iteritems():
+        for filtername, filtervalue in filters.items():
             if attr_to_filter[filtername]:
                 new_filtername = attr_to_filter[filtername]
                 mapped_filters[new_filtername] = filtervalue